What is APEXFiz®?

If you’re in the fashion and apparel industry, you might have heard of the "SDS®-ONE APEX Series." The SDS®-ONE APEX Series is a hardware-integrated design system that comes installed with specialized design and simulation software.

Already used by major apparel and knitwear manufacturers worldwide, it’s often implemented alongside the well-known 3D software, CLO. The high quality of fabric simulation is one of its praised features, leading to its broad application in the industry.

Additionally, it offers a variety of features needed to create virtual samples, such as yarn design, colorway, pattern creation, knit and woven fabric simulation, and dressing 3D models. It's a very rich software package.

However, being an all-in-one solution, some users find it expensive. Also, for some users, the inclusion of unused features makes it difficult to fully utilize, becoming a barrier to purchase.

On the other hand, APEXFiz®, released in 2021, is a software version that breaks down the many features of the SDS®-ONE APEX Series into four commonly used combinations. It is sold in a subscription format, making it affordable to introduce.

Which Company Makes APEXFiz®?

The company behind the development and sales of APEXFiz® is Shima Seiki Originally established about 60 years ago to develop, manufacture, and sell industrial knitting machines, Shima Seiki also has a long history in software development. Their first design system was completed in 1981, making them a well-established company with around 40 years in the field.

The development of their graphic software began in 1979 when NASA decommissioned three graphic boards to the private sector. Shima Seiki acquired one of these boards, and interestingly, Steve Jobs, the founder of Apple, also obtained one of these rare graphic processing foundations.

SDS®-ONE APEX series and APEXFiz® are software developed by a knitting machine manufacturer, making them particularly strong in coordinating with flat knitting production. However, due to the abundance of uniquely developed features, they are widely applicable not only in fashion but also in other industries.

In the past, Shima Seiki was also known for developing the Hyper Paint II design system, which boasted the world's fastest image processing capabilities at the time, for industries like broadcasting, architecture, and automotive.

Knit Design

ニットプログラミムデータ自動生成

This feature is included in APEXFiz® Design-Knit.

It supports the design of both flat knitting and circular knitting. For example, even with jacquard patterns, the program can automatically convert the design into the required number of stitches for production while creating the data simultaneously.

This ensures that the designer's intentions are efficiently and accurately communicated to the production site, facilitating smooth communication.

Woven Fabric Design

テキスタイルシミュレーション

This feature is included in APEXFiz® Design-Weave.

You can design various woven fabrics such as stripes, checks, and jacquard patterns. It is used not only in the apparel industry but also in the interior industry. The software also supports the simulation of brushed and wrinkled finishes. Since it can simulate pile fabrics, it is also popular in the towel industry.
